Yakushima is among the most ecologically singular places in Japan — an island off the southern tip of Kagoshima prefecture whose mountainous interior generates so much precipitation (up to 10 meters annually in some high-altitude areas) that it has sustained one of the world's most ancient living forests. The yakusugi cedar trees of Yakushima — cryptomeria growing at altitude, some estimated at over 7,000 years — were part of the UNESCO World Heritage designation that Yakushima received in 1993, the same year as Himeji Castle, an unusual coupling that signals the scale of the island's significance.
Sankara Hotel & Spa Yakushima occupies this landscape as a boutique property whose scale is deliberately proportioned to the environment it inhabits: small enough to be present within the island's character rather than overwhelming it, and serious enough in its hospitality to justify the considerable logistical commitment that reaching Yakushima requires (ferry from Kagoshima, or small aircraft). The spa uses the island's natural environment as both context and resource, incorporating the mineral-rich water and botanical elements of the surrounding forest.
Forest trekking to the yakusugi trees, the waterfalls and rivers of the island's interior, and the coastal landscapes of the surrounding East China Sea and Pacific provide the activities around which a Yakushima stay is organized. Sankara's dining uses the island's own produce — seafood from the surrounding waters, mountain vegetables, and the flying fish that are a Yakushima specialty — in a culinary program that reflects the island's ecological character.
